What was the Nikola Badger truck?

The Nikola Badger truck was first announced in February 2020. At the time, it was said to be the most promising alternative to Tesla's Cybertruck. An all-electric pickup, the truck's creators planned to make two variants: -

  • The first was to be a battery and hydrogen fuel cell variant.
  • The second was a planned all-electric variant with no fuel cells.
